EPS 200 Hind is a type of expanded polystyrene that has a high density of 200 kg/m3 This high-density EPS material is known for its strength, durability, and excellent thermal insulation properties EPS 200 Hind is commonly used in applications that require superior strength and thermal insulation, such as building insulation, packaging, and automotive components.
One of the main advantages of EPS 200 Hind is its lightweight nature Despite its high density, EPS 200 Hind is lightweight and easy to handle, making it ideal for applications where weight is a concern This makes EPS 200 Hind a popular choice for packaging materials, as it can provide protection for fragile items without adding unnecessary weight.
In addition to its lightweight properties, EPS 200 Hind also offers excellent thermal insulation The closed-cell structure of EPS 200 Hind traps air inside the material, creating a barrier that helps to regulate temperature and reduce energy consumption This makes EPS 200 Hind a cost-effective solution for insulation in buildings, refrigeration units, and other applications where thermal efficiency is important.
The durability of EPS 200 Hind is another key feature that sets it apart from other materials The high-density structure of EPS 200 Hind makes it resistant to compression and damage, ensuring that it can withstand heavy loads and rough handling This durability makes EPS 200 Hind an excellent choice for packaging materials, shock absorbers, and other applications where strength and reliability are essential.

In the construction industry, EPS 200 Hind is often used as insulation material in walls, roofs, and floors The thermal insulation properties of EPS 200 Hind help to improve energy efficiency and reduce heating and cooling costs in buildings EPS 200 Hind is also resistant to moisture, mold, and pests, making it a durable and long-lasting insulation solution for both residential and commercial structures.
In the packaging industry, EPS 200 Hind is widely used for protecting fragile items during shipping and handling The lightweight and shock-absorbing properties of EPS 200 Hind help to prevent damage to products and reduce the risk of breakage EPS 200 Hind can be molded into custom shapes and sizes to fit the specific dimensions of items, providing a secure and reliable packaging solution for a wide range of products.
